The work of mechanical engineering technologists varies by industry and function and can be found within manufacturing plants, engineering and business service companies, and federal, state, and local government. MET tend to work in manufacturing in which their responsibility includes the development and evaluation of machines, design of mechanical systems, facilitating operation and management, quality control, and supervision of workers. These positions can be found in consumer products, transportation equipment, automobile, aircraft, and industrial machinery industries. MET graduates also have the opportunity to work as a researcher in which they can build or set up equipment, complete experiments, and design prototype mechanical systems.
Other opportunities for MET graduates are consulting, technical sales, production operations, and administration. The MET graduate is prepared to immediately begin technical assignments since technology programs stress current industrial practices and design procedures.
According to the National Society of Professional Engineers, engineering technologist positions apply engineering and scientific knowledge and technical skills to support engineering designs. Mechanical engineering technologists use current engineering techniques and methods in industry, while mechanical engineers develop new methods and techniques. METs can move into industrial supervisory positions, unlike Mechanical Engineering (ME) graduates. A Mechanical Engineering Technology degree is achieved by studying the current manufacturing and engineering practices in use. ME is based more on theory whereas MET is more practical. A person holding a MET degree can join a job straight away after completing it because they have already learned about current technology whereas a ME graduate might have to intern in order to apply what he has learned in school to real-world applications.
